I have not been following this thread but I am excited to see it.
I have been looking for soemthing to strap to my mojo. Currently using an old z3 compact phone which is working well, but something even more DAC/AMP for purpose would be great.
I think it ticks most of the boxes for me, except I have no need of Headphone Out and Line Out on such a device.
Optical, Coax, USB digital out and I am happy.
THat being said I would love to see 2 usb ports, one for charging, one for data. Reason being so I dont have to unplug my dac every time I need to charge the transport.
Other than this, I think it looks good!

If people are focus on a " Pure " transport which not includes any DAC/AMP, it can be very easy to us to make such products in 1 week and just remove the DAC/AMP from the PCBA.
for example, a X3/X5/X7 without amp/dac, will it satisfy our customers ? I don't think so. the key is not with or without amp/DAC , the key is size, price, storage, more digital/analog output and others.
So, if we make a X3II without DAC/AMP , will you buy it ?
